Can we just give Liverpool the Premier League title now?It may only be December but the Reds’ lead at the top of the table appears to be unassailable.They are 10 points clear of second-placed Leicester after a day in which results went their way.In the early kick-off, Jurgen Klopp’s side defeated Watford 2-0 thanks to a brace from Mohamed Salah.Then at 3pm, Leicester were held to a 1-1 draw by Norwich City.

Norwich have been on a miserable run of form lately, winning just one of their previous 11 games heading into the Leicester match.

But they managed to secure a point at the King Power Stadium, producing a resilient display to frustrate Brendan Rodgers’ team.

And while Daniel Farke’s side still sit in the relegation zone, they are quickly becoming every Liverpool supporter’s second-favourite team.

The Canaries have taken points from Liverpool’s two main title rivals - Manchester City and Leicester City - and also beat Everton this season.

Norwich City help Liverpool:

  • September 14: Norwich City 3-2 Man City
  • November 23: Everton 0-2 Norwich City
  • December 14: Leicester City 1-1 Norwich City

Oh, and Norwich also helped Liverpool get their season off to a thumping start when they were beaten 4-1 at Anfield in August.
